Transaction 08287e1ac93ef50f5e020275f4a1eecdaac97ce5c568174687ff2ecafcf23726
1 Input
2 Outputs
- 08287e1ac93ef50f5e020275f4a1eecdaac97ce5c568174687ff2ecafcf23726:0
- 08287e1ac93ef50f5e020275f4a1eecdaac97ce5c568174687ff2ecafcf23726:1
value 169326182
address 1EWyYw9BzRgCBNafqh5dzpWYjH3bwgExUm
value 2044562
address 3MGnS1atMvPWjFiRY5AVJhf9KYwiGG8HxN